QUOTE(DaCoach @ Mar 3 2007 - 05:37 AM) 826397960[/snapback]I have watched every home basketball game that UHS has played since 1998. My wife is the Head Softball Coach and my son was the starting right tackle on the football team. For the last 10 years, I have been the Head Middle School football coach at Cornerstone, so to say that we are big Upperman fans would be a big understatement. But lets look at this from a logical point of view:

 

1. Coaching: Dana McWilliams has won nearly 350 games in her 12 years as head mentor of the Lady Bees. After an outstanding career as a player for UHS then she went on to play for Motlow Jr. College before transfering to Tennessee Tech( and we all know how excellent they are). Her main assistants are all-OVC player of the year Emily Christian(who is also a UHS grad) and played pro ball in Greece. Emily's accomplishments both in college and High School are too numberus to mention. She also has Amber Rose who started 4 years at Costal Carolina and also has too many high school and college honors to mention. Add to that mix is Amanda Austin, another all-state performer who chose to for go college in order to start a family and become anoutstanding member of the community. Coaching Staff gets A t pluses all the way.

 

2. Team leaders: Seniors Megan Simmons, Jessie Bourch-Jensen, Britney Tisdal, and Chelsea Taylor have all shown that tey are willing to do what it takes to help the TEAM WIN. If some of the unerclassmen are hot, they will gladly feed the the ball. If it means to be on the bench while the "starters" are being announced, they will do that. When comes down to a close game these seniors will take the lead and show these younger players how to get the win and also show them how to do it with class.

 

3. Youth on the team: How many teams do you know that is this good and starts a freshman, 2 sophomores, a junior and only one senior. Also there will be times in a tight game that Upperman will have 2 freshmen and 3 sophomores on the floor. That is almost unheard of on most teams.

 

4. The ability to win games with inside shooting of Dyer, Tisdal, Bourch-Jensen, and Taylor. Then when the defense packs it in, the big guns of Maynard, Davis, Simmons, Taylor, Roberts, Bourch-Jensen will then shhot you out of a zone with the 3 point shot. If you want to run and gun, That's great for us because we can go 12 deep on our bench without losing anything. Really we coul go as many as 15 deep and still compeat and defeat most AA teams.
